Ralph M. Angelotti, Jr.

October 17, 1932 — February 18, 2017

Surrounded by his loving family on Saturday, February 18, 2017, age 84, of Westmont, NJ.

Beloved husband of Carmen G. (Nee Garcia). Loving father of Suzanne Montemurro, Ralph Angelotti and his wife Joan, Christopher Angelotti and his wife Patricia, the late Carmen Marie Merget and Beatrice Angelotti.  Dear brother of MaryLou Meloni and the late Michael Angelotti. Proud grandfather of William Merget, Alyssa Montemurro, Christopher Michael Angelotti, Stephanie Merget, Patricia Angelotti, Frank Montemurro and Christopher Michael Angelotti.

Ralph was a US Air Force Veteran serving in the Korean War. He enjoyed trips to the Berlin Auction, where he brought the items he had tinkered with to sell. One of Ralph’s proud moments in life was when he received the Carnegie Hero Award in 1994 (Please read description below).

"Ralph M. Angelotti helped to save Gregory T. Hoffman from drowning, Westmont, New Jersey, July 17, 1994.  Gregory 7, was struggling to stay
afloat in Crystal Lake after the car in which he had been a passenger entered the lake.  Runoff from a torrential rain during the preceding hours had flooded the stream-fed lake, causing a strong current.  Angelotti, 61, retired business owner, had just arrived at the lake when he saw a man wading in the flood water in a rescue attempt.  Angelotti then saw Gregory bobbing in the water farther out; he immediately removed his shoes, dove into the lake, and swam to Gregory.  He grasped Gregory, who had just submerged, then swam against the current back toward the bank. The other man extended a branch to Angelotti and pulled him and Gregory in.  Gregory was hospitalized overnight for treatment.  Angelotti was winded, but he recovered."
